One of the most popular Sudanese dishes that can be found in Warsaw is "Ful Medames," a hearty breakfast dish made from fava beans cooked with onions, garlic, and spices. This dish is often served with bread and topped with a variety of toppings like hard-boiled eggs, tomatoes, and tahini sauce. Another beloved Sudanese dish is "Mulah," a spicy stew made with okra, tomatoes, and either meat or fish. This dish is typically served with Sudanese flatbread called "Kisra."
